The Ultimate Guide to Choosing a Tonneau Cover for Your Ram 2500 with RamBox
Owning a Ram 2500 with the RamBox Cargo Management System is a game changer. These side storage bins make organizing tools and gear easy. However, they also change the shape of your truck bed. You cannot use standard tonneau covers. You need a cover specifically designed to work with the unique width and rail system of the RamBox.
Key Features to Look For
First, check for “RamBox compatibility.” Not every cover fits. You must select a model that accounts for the extra width of the storage bins. Second, look for a “low-profile” design. This keeps the cover flush with the truck bed, which looks sleek and improves gas mileage. Third, consider the locking mechanism. Some covers lock automatically when you close your tailgate, while others require manual latches.
Important Materials
- Aluminum Panels: These are very strong and offer the best security. They handle heavy snow and weight well.
- Marine-Grade Vinyl: This material is flexible and lightweight. It is a great choice if you need to open and close your bed frequently.
- Fiberglass/Composite: These materials are tough and resist dents. They provide a high-end look that matches the truck’s paint.
Factors That Improve or Reduce Quality
Quality often comes down to the weather seals. A top-tier cover uses thick rubber gaskets to keep water and dust out of your bed. Poor-quality covers use thin, cheap foam that rots over time. Another factor is the hinge system. High-quality covers use smooth, heavy-duty hinges that won’t stick. Avoid covers with plastic latches, as these often break under cold temperatures.
User Experience and Use Cases
If you use your truck for work, a hard folding cover is best. You can fold it up to haul large items and unfold it to keep your tools secure. If you just want to keep your groceries dry, a soft roll-up cover is more affordable and very easy to use. Think about how often you access your RamBox bins, too. Some covers allow you to open the bins without lifting the tonneau, while others require you to open the cover first.
10 Frequently Asked Questions
Q: Will a standard Ram 2500 cover fit my RamBox truck?
A: No. RamBox trucks have different bed dimensions. You must buy a cover specifically labeled for the RamBox system.
Q: Can I still open my RamBox bins with the cover closed?
A: Most covers allow this. However, check the specific product description to ensure it does not block the lid access.
Q: Which cover provides the best security?
A: Hard tri-fold or hard rolling covers made of aluminum offer the highest level of security for your gear.
Q: Are these covers waterproof?
A: Most covers are “weather-resistant.” They keep out almost all rain, but a few drops might enter near the tailgate in heavy storms.
Q: Can I install these covers by myself?
A: Yes. Most covers use “clamp-on” systems that require no drilling. You can usually finish the job in under an hour.
Q: Do I need to remove the cover to haul large items?
A: Not usually. Most folding or rolling covers allow you to expose 75% to 100% of the bed without removing the entire unit.
Q: How does a tonneau cover help with gas mileage?
A: It reduces wind drag in the truck bed. This can lead to a small but noticeable increase in fuel efficiency.
Q: Can I wash my truck through an automatic car wash with the cover on?
A: Yes, provided the cover is securely latched. High-quality covers are designed to handle high-pressure water.
Q: How long should a good cover last?
A: A high-quality cover should last 5 to 10 years with proper care and regular cleaning of the seals.
Q: What is the best way to clean my cover?
A: Use mild soap and water with a soft cloth. Avoid harsh chemicals or stiff brushes that can scratch the surface.
